Does anybody know of something to plant for the winter that would attract doves late season and is also a nitrogen booster?
Look at the law there is a date you can top sow(half ass plant)wheat and it might attract a few
it has to be acting as planting a food plot like preparing the ground you can’t sow it in a pasture or bush hogged weeds
 
Look at the law there is a date you can top sow(half ass plant)wheat and it might attract a few
I was really thinking about planting some winter rye but i don’t know if doves would eat it. I just know I’ve seen a **** ton of doves around here in December and would like to attract at least some of them. 😂
 
Yeah, unless you have a stand of something to cut, the next best thing is top sowing winter wheat. Foster is correct on the legality part too. It used to be legal. It was pretty much baiting though, so they made some law. Probably one you wouldn’t want to find out about the hard way. We have had some outstanding hunting on top sow wheat.
